A recent Quinnipiac College Poll surveyed New Jersey voters' sports interests and focused on interest in supporting a Yankees move from New York to the Meadowlands. The poll of 867 NJ residents who say they are registered voters was conducted April 1-6 with a margin of error of +/- 3.3%. The poll surveyed fans on the subject of their favorite pro teams. In the NBA, 23% named the Knicks as their favorite team; 10%, Bulls; 7%, 76ers; 5%, Nets. With the NFL, 27% named the Giants as their favorite team; 13%, Eagles; 5%, Jets. In the NHL, 24% list the Devils, 16%, Flyers; 14%, Rangers. For MLB, 36% named the Yankees their favorite team; 13% tabbed the Phillies; 11% named the Mets. The following lists a statewide breakdown of voters' preferences on the future of the Yankees, compared to a similar poll from the end of '96 (Quinnipiac College).
SHOULD YANKEES STAY IN NEW YORK OR MOVE TO NEW JERSEY? |
| TOT | SOUTH | CENTRAL | NORTH | DEC '96 |
Stay in New York | 44% | 45% | 36% | 48% | 48% |
Move to New Jersey | 36% | 32% | 39% | 38% | 27% |
Don't Know/No Answer | 20% | 23% | 25% | 15% | 24% |
WHO SHOULD PAY FOR STADIUM IF YANKEES MOVE TO NEW JERSEY? |
| TOT | SOUTH | CENTRAL | NORTH | DEC '96 |
The State | 7% | 6% | 6% | 8% | 6% |
Independent/ Meadowlands | 29% | 27% | 30% | 29% | 30% |
Yankees | 55% | 58% | 55% | 54% | 55% |
Don't Know/ No Answer | 9% | 9% | 9% | 9% | 9% |
IF YANKS MOVED TO N.J., MORE LIKELY OR LESS TO ATTEND A GAME? |
| TOT | SOUTH | CENTRAL | NORTH | DEC '96 |
More Likely | 37% | 20% | 40% | 47% | 35% |
Less Likely | 6% | 8% | 6% | 5% | 5% |
No Difference | 55% | 71% | 52% | 47% | 58% |
Don't Know/No Answer | 1% | 1% | 1% | 2% | 2% |
